Management Accounting and Strategy
is designed for executives and professionals seeking to enhance their skills in advanced management accounting and strategic decision-making. This Graduate Certificate program focuses on developing expertise in financial analysis, performance measurement, and strategic planning. It equips learners with the knowledge and tools necessary to drive business growth and improvement.
Through a combination of theoretical foundations and practical applications, participants will learn to analyze complex business problems, develop effective management accounting systems, and create strategic plans that drive business success.
Some key topics covered in the program include financial modeling, cost management, and performance evaluation. Participants will also explore the role of management accounting in driving organizational change and innovation.

The Graduate Certificate in Advanced Management Accounting and Strategy is a postgraduate program designed for individuals seeking to enhance their management accounting and strategic management skills.
This program is ideal for those who have a bachelor's degree in any field and wish to acquire advanced knowledge in management accounting and strategy.
Upon completion of the program, students can expect to gain a deeper understanding of management accounting principles, including financial analysis, budgeting, and forecasting.
Additionally, students will learn strategic management concepts, such as competitive analysis, market research, and organizational behavior.
The program is delivered over one year, with students typically completing two semesters of study.
